Scrapping user fees “just the first step”

by IRIN | on Sep24 2009

NAIROBI, 24 September 2009 (IRIN) – Donor-backed user fees for health services were supposed to decentralise primary healthcare and provide revenue for essential drugs: instead, advocacy groups charge, they have ended up killing the poor in the developing world.
